The reasoning behind this verdict
This section explains the evidence supporting the verdict and keeps conflicting or missing signals visible.
The executable is consistently identified as a keygen, crack tool, or patcher by 49 of 75 engines, including eight tier-1 detections. Confirmed hacktool labeling, process-injection evidence, defense-impairment activity, packing, and the absence of a signature make execution an unacceptable risk.
The strongest evidence is the confirmed hacktool classification: Microsoft, TrendMicro, BitDefender, Emsisoft, GData, and other engines independently identify keygen or patcher functionality. Overall, 49 of 75 engines detect the file, including eight tier-1 detections and strong tier-1 agreement on the Keygen family. One completed sandbox recorded T1055, T1543.003, and T1562.001, covering process injection, service-related activity, and impairment of defenses, although it did not issue its own malware verdict. The executable is unsigned and likely packed, with entropy 8 in its UPX1 section, increasing the risk that its code is intentionally obscured. No external-research hit or confirmed malicious child was found, but those counter-signals do not outweigh the corroborated hacktool labels and offensive runtime techniques.

How hacktools are abused
This is a hacking or cracking tool — the kind used to bypass software licences, generate fake keys, or attack other systems. Even when the tool 'works', these downloads very often carry hidden malware.
Bottom line:Running one means trusting an anonymous author with full access to your PC — rarely worth the risk.
